Benutzer mit den meisten Antworten
F#

Frage
-
Hallo zusammen, das ist meine erste Frage hier, also bitte einfach sagen, wenn ich vergesse was anzugeben ;)
Ich versuche mich gerade damit verschiedene Algorithmen mit F# zu lösen. Das meiste ist kein Problem. Jetzt habe ich aber das Problem, das einige Algorithmen recht lange zur Ausführung brauchen, darum lasse ich die Konsole im Hintergrund laufen, nur dann bekomme ich nicht mit wann der Algorithmus fertig ist. Gibt es da eine Möglichkeit, die Konsole in den Vordergrund zuu bringen o.ä.?
PS: Warum gibt es kein eigenes Forum für F#? Das richtige Forum auszuwählen ist nicht gerade einfach gewesen, wenn nicht sogar falsch. Auf der englischen MSDN Webseite gibt es so ein Forum, bin aber nicht so gut in Englisch, deshalb frage ich hier.
Antworten
-
Hallo, du kannst Beispielsweise eine Datei oder ein Programm starten:
open System.Threading; open System.Diagnostics; open System; [<EntryPoint>] let main argv = Thread.Sleep(2000) Process.Start(new ProcessStartInfo( @"C:\alarm.wav")) |> ignore 0
Oder auch einen Sound wiedergeben:open System.Threading; open System.Media; open System; [<EntryPoint>] let main argv = Thread.Sleep(2000) let sp = new SoundPlayer(@"C:\alarm.wav") sp.PlayLooping() Console.ReadLine()|>ignore sp.Stop() 0
PS: Es gibt hier leider noch kein F# Forum da es nicht sonderlich viele Fragen zu F# gibt.
http://social.msdn.microsoft.com/Forums/de-DE/msdngenerelle_fragende/thread/8e445291-31e7-47bf-a710-802eadf7ce44/
Wobei das auch nicht mehr der neueste Thread ist.
Koopakiller [kuːpakɪllɐ] | Webseite | Code Beispiele | Facebook | Snippets
- Bearbeitet Tom Lambert (Koopakiller)Moderator Freitag, 4. Januar 2013 18:54 PS
- Als Antwort vorgeschlagen Tom Lambert (Koopakiller)Moderator Montag, 21. Januar 2013 17:40
- Als Antwort markiert Robert BreitenhoferModerator Freitag, 25. Januar 2013 12:26
Alle Antworten
-
Hallo, du kannst Beispielsweise eine Datei oder ein Programm starten:
open System.Threading; open System.Diagnostics; open System; [<EntryPoint>] let main argv = Thread.Sleep(2000) Process.Start(new ProcessStartInfo( @"C:\alarm.wav")) |> ignore 0
Oder auch einen Sound wiedergeben:open System.Threading; open System.Media; open System; [<EntryPoint>] let main argv = Thread.Sleep(2000) let sp = new SoundPlayer(@"C:\alarm.wav") sp.PlayLooping() Console.ReadLine()|>ignore sp.Stop() 0
PS: Es gibt hier leider noch kein F# Forum da es nicht sonderlich viele Fragen zu F# gibt.
http://social.msdn.microsoft.com/Forums/de-DE/msdngenerelle_fragende/thread/8e445291-31e7-47bf-a710-802eadf7ce44/
Wobei das auch nicht mehr der neueste Thread ist.
Koopakiller [kuːpakɪllɐ] | Webseite | Code Beispiele | Facebook | Snippets
- Bearbeitet Tom Lambert (Koopakiller)Moderator Freitag, 4. Januar 2013 18:54 PS
- Als Antwort vorgeschlagen Tom Lambert (Koopakiller)Moderator Montag, 21. Januar 2013 17:40
- Als Antwort markiert Robert BreitenhoferModerator Freitag, 25. Januar 2013 12:26
-
Hallo _.-'-._,
Ich gehe davon aus, dass die Antwort Dir weitergeholfen hat.
Solltest Du noch "Rückfragen" dazu haben, so gib uns bitte Bescheid.Grüße,
RobertRobert Breitenhofer, MICROSOFT
Bitte haben Sie Verständnis dafür, dass im Rahmen dieses Forums, welches auf dem Community-Prinzip „Entwickler helfen Entwickler“ beruht, kein technischer Support geleistet werden kann oder sonst welche garantierten Maßnahmen seitens Microsoft zugesichert werden können.
-
PS: Warum gibt es kein eigenes Forum für F#? Das richtige Forum auszuwählen ist nicht gerade einfach gewesen, wenn nicht sogar falsch.
Hallo _.-'-._,
Lies bitte mal folgendes:
Eine Übersicht über alle verfügbaren Microsoft Foren findest Du unter [Info]
Eine Übersicht über alle verfügbaren Microsoft Hilfe & Support-Angebot findest Du unter http://www.msdn-support.de
Grüße,
Robert
Robert Breitenhofer, MICROSOFT
Bitte haben Sie Verständnis dafür, dass im Rahmen dieses Forums, welches auf dem Community-Prinzip „Entwickler helfen Entwickler“ beruht, kein technischer Support geleistet werden kann oder sonst welche garantierten Maßnahmen seitens Microsoft zugesichert werden können.